    • Type of service

    You may need a locksmith to install deadbolts, rekey, unlock a house, change locks, upgrade to electronic locks, extract or duplicate keys, unlock a car or safe, etc. Some jobs cost a paltry sum, such as copying a key of the traditional lock. However, key extraction can be slightly expensive depending on the complexity of the work and the type of lock involved. The charges can be high when dealing with car transponder keys or electronic locks in the house. How do you take a call with a specific lock situation? Typically, homeowners struggle to decide whether they should replace or rekey locks. Rekeying is an affordable and faster solution. If you want to continue using the existing lock system, your locksmith can recommend rekeying, which involves working with the pins in the lock’s cylinder. It requires a new key. 

    • Standard vs. electronic locks

    A locksmith can install different locks easily. However, some options require more effort and precision. If you switch to electric locks, you may have to spend more on each lock. Opting for a keyless locking mechanism is good, but its installation process can be slightly complex. Due to this, your locksmith can charge a higher price. At the same time, lock technology can also affect service costs.

    • Service hours

    Anyone can ignore this area, but locksmiths face high demand for their services during some specific hours, especially in the morning and evening. These are the times when you’re more likely to misplace or lose your keys, often realizing it only when you need them the most. So, you may pay a surcharge. 

    • Additional information

    You cannot avoid taking professional help with lock repair or installation. However, there are ways to reduce the service cost. A spare key should always be easily accessible for you. If keys are getting older, you should get them duplicated on time. Call a local locksmith for maintenance to avoid sudden developments with keys or locks. Also, let the professional know about the lock issue so they come prepared for it. If you can wait, try calling them during regular hours. Those who want to use keyless options can rely on Wi-Fi or Bluetooth-enabled locks for some cost savings. 

    When you hire a locksmith for any specific concern, study their background. Look for insurance, training, and other such details.
